The 2-135th Army Aviation Battalion: A Legacy of Valor and Service. Buckley Space Force Base, Aurora, CO.

The 2-135th Army Aviation Battalion stands as a testament to the indomitable spirit of service, carrying a combat lineage dating back to the crucible of World War II. Throughout its storied history, this esteemed unit has played a pivotal role in shaping the course of military operations, earning accolades for its unwavering commitment to duty and exceptional performance in the face of adversity.

The 2-135th Army Aviation Battalion stands as a paragon of valor, service, and adaptability. With a combat lineage spanning generations, the battalion continues to embody the principles of duty, honor, and selfless service. Whether in the heat of battle, the aftermath of natural disasters, or the tranquility of domestic operations, the 2-135th AVN remains steadfast in its mission to serve and protect, leaving an indelible mark on the tapestry of military history.
